Right Distance or Right Presence?

ABSTRACT

At a time when experts confront each other in order to determine what is essential to knowledge and didactics, to the logic of intention or to the logic of competence, it is necessary to recall that the only thing that the teacher can transmit is the will to know. Neither teaching nor didactics allows the learner to economize in the transition to the act. It is only when the student has decided to learn that they will acquire the knowledge and skills to succeed. It is essential to stimulate the student to act, remembering that, to be viable, the pedagogic relationship must be inscribed within an ethical, institutional and relational system, avoiding dependence or indifference to any of these. How then to convey the will to know without manipulating the student by means of didactic, relational or institutional strategies? How could the presence of the teacher be used to enhance the process of learning? What distances should be respected in order to sustain interest?
